this post was submitted on 28 Oct 2024
13 points (93.3% liked)

Forum Libre

737 readers
57 users here now

Communautés principales de l'instance

Nous rejoindre sur Matrix: https://matrix.to/#/#jlai.lu:matrix.org

Une communauté pour discuter de tout et de rien:

Les mots d'ordre sont : respect et bienveillance.

Les discussions politiques sont déconseillées, et ont davantage leur place sur

Les règles de l'instance sont bien entendu d'application.

Fils hebdomadaires"

"Demandez-moi n'importe quoi"

Communautés détendues

Communautés liées:

Loisirs:

Vie Pratique:

Communautés d'actualité

Société:

Pays:

Communauté de secours:

founded 1 year ago
MODERATORS
 

Hello ! Finalement, comme annoncé la semaine dernière, on va bien se faire un petit Twitch avec un ami pour montrer comment on peut coder aujourd'hui quasiment sans écrire de code. Ce sera à 18 heures vendredi prochain (1er novembre). et on va essayer de programmer un petit jeu. Notre objectif c'est qu'à la fin de la session, (probablement 2-3 heures), on arrive au point où on puisse inviter les gens qui seront sur le chat à venir dans notre jeu et jouer ensemble.

On va essayer de faire un jeu multijoueur en réseau, on n'a pas encore décidé de quelle forme, donc n'hésitez pas à donner vos idées en commentaire.

Moi, j'ai tendance à partir un peu sur le spatial, mon pote aime bien les univers solarpunk, je pensais faire un truc avec des vaisseaux ou des zeppelins, mais ça peut être aussi du RPG à la Zelda, de la plateforme, de la bagnole ou d'autres idées que vous pouvez avoir. Je pense que les trucs 3D, ça rajoute un peu de complexité, mais on peut essayer. Perso, j'aime bien les jeux de gestion et les RPGs, mais on peut expérimenter d'autres choses.

Ce sera là dessus: https://www.twitch.tv/ktp_programming

EDIT: Ah oui petite précision: on des devs expérimentés qui sommes bluffés par les nouveaux outils, le but est de montrer aux débutants et aux confirmés ce qu'ils permettent aujourd'hui. On va a priori faire les choses en python, et soit pygame ou OpenGL pour les graphismes. Et peut être ouvrir sur quelques discussions un peu plus larges si l'occasion se présente. Personnellement je pense que ça peut intéresser particulièrement les gens qui ont un vague intérêt pour la programmation mais ont étés rebutés par la pratique.

EDIT2: On galère 5 mins avant le début, on arrive!

EDIT3: Bon bah ça c'est pas super bien passé, on a galéré à faire des choses simples, je pense qu'on a fait l'erreur de se lancer dans du HTML/JS alors qu'on n'était pas super à l'aise avec ça.

top 17 comments
sorted by: hot top controversial new old
[–] keepthepace 5 points 3 weeks ago (2 children)
[–] lascapi@jlai.lu 3 points 3 weeks ago

Salut, merci pour le ping ! Je ne serai pas dispo je pense à cette heure, je regarderai volontiers le replay :)

[–] Sravoryk@jlai.lu 2 points 3 weeks ago

Yo, je devrais pouvoir être présent ! Merci !

[–] Snoopy@jlai.lu 3 points 3 weeks ago (1 children)

Du coup, je vais m'inspirer de minetest/luana : créer un jeu avec des zones qui ont leur propres règles physiques.

Tu parlais de spatial et solarpunk. Hé bien les 2 sont possibles ! ☺️

Sur notre ancien serveur minetest on avait un vaisseau spatial et une ville mais pas de création de zones avec des règles physiques, climats. On pourrait imaginer aussi des zones de transistion.

Yavait aussi des "area container" pour créer un espace dans un espace. Peut-etre ya un moyen de passer du macro au micro ? :)

[–] keepthepace 3 points 3 weeks ago (1 children)

Alors je sais pas si c'est à ça que tu penses quand tu parles de règles physiques, mais à un moment je réfléchissais un peu à un univers de combats de magiciens, dans une ambiance à la Magic The Gathering, où on progresse et on s'affronte non pas en se tapant dessus avec des armées mais en influençant des biomes respectifs...

D'un coté je suis très tenté d'explorer des concepts de gameplay un peu nouveau, autant sur une première séance, je préfère rester en terrain un peu connu!

[–] Snoopy@jlai.lu 1 points 3 weeks ago

Un peu ça oui. Et je voyais chaque box biomes avec un système de node comme les textures blender. Et créer des combinaisons :)

[–] pseudo@jlai.lu 2 points 3 weeks ago (1 children)

Super! Merci de nous faire partager ton expérimentation. Deux petites questions :
Tu as déjà la date et l'heure ?
Faut-il un compte pour suivre le direct ?

[–] keepthepace 3 points 3 weeks ago* (last edited 3 weeks ago) (2 children)

18h vendredi prochain (1er novembre).

Non twitch ne demande pas de compte pour suivre le streaming, par contre il en demande un (gratuit) pour participer au chat. Désolé, j'espérais qu'on puisse expérimenter une plateforme un peu plus libre en la matière mais on n'a pas eu le temps de mettre ça en place.

[–] pseudo@jlai.lu 2 points 3 weeks ago (1 children)

Et merci de prendre le temps de répondre alors que j'avais mal lu ton message 🙂

[–] keepthepace 2 points 3 weeks ago
[–] pseudo@jlai.lu 2 points 3 weeks ago (1 children)

Il ne faut pas trop se mettre de barrière au départ sinon on ne commence jamais. Je passerai peut-être mais je ne ferai pas de compte pour l'occasion.

[–] keepthepace 2 points 3 weeks ago

Comme tu le sens! De toutes façons le stream sera long, si jamais l'envie te prend de dire quelque chose t'aura largement le temps de créer un compte pendant!

[–] lascapi@jlai.lu 2 points 2 weeks ago (1 children)

Salut, je viens de regarder les replays, c’est vrai que ça avait l’air galère.

Mais j’ai apprécié de voir l’environnement de travail et particulièrement comment les LLM sont inclut dans les IDE.

[–] keepthepace 3 points 2 weeks ago (2 children)

On va retenter le coup, mais je pense qu'il faut qu'on se concentre à faire un résumé youtube. Je pense que je vais pas faire la pub des prochains jusqu'à ce que je sois content du résultat.

Le pire c'est que j'étais tellement déçu au retour que de retour chez moi j'ai fait plein de trucs (en pygame et OpenGL, que je connais bien) qui ont immédiatement bien marché!

[–] lascapi@jlai.lu 4 points 2 weeks ago (1 children)

Je trouve ça intéressant que tu te sentes plus à l’aise d’utiliser une IA pour des technos que tu connais bien alors qu’un argument de vente c’est justement que les débutants peuvent coder comme des pros.

Est-ce que tu penses que c’est réaliste comme propos ?

[–] keepthepace 4 points 2 weeks ago

Je le croyais et j'ai depuis mis un peu d'eau dans mon vin. Je dirais que c'est probablement un boost de vitesse genre x10 en vitesse de codage. Je suis bon en python, du coup je vais vraiment très vite avec ces outils.

Je suis capable de bricoler en HTML/JS, du coup j'arrive à faire des choses qui sinon me demanderaient beaucoup plus de temps.

Je devrais essayer dans un domaine où je ne connais strictement rien, genre du Haskell, et voir si ça marche bien. Je pense qu'un débutant ira surement 10x plus vite aussi, mais il semble y avoir encore une vraie valeur à l'expertise.

Je ne sais pas à quel point c'est lié au fait que le modèle est très entrainé sur du python, au fait que c'est également ma spécialité (avec le C/C++), au fait qu'on a tenté de faire un truc en HTML/JS un truc pas vraiment facile avec ces technos...

En fait je réapprends mon métier avec ces outils, et je tente de garder les yeux ouverts. Y a des choses qu'ils savent bien faire, d'autres moins, d'autres il faut savoir comment les gérer.

[–] Snoopy@jlai.lu 3 points 2 weeks ago

En version indirecte c'est bien aussi et moins de pression ☺️